Central Banks: A cornucopia of monetary policy meetings scheduled next week includes the Federal Reserve, the Bank of Japan, European Central Bank, Bank of England, and monetary authorities in Switzerland, Russia, Turkey, Norway, Hungary, Indonesia, Taiwan, the Philippines, Mexico, Chile and Colombia. The dollar is unchanged compared to late Thursday against the yen, loonie, peso, sterling and measured by the weighted DXY index. The dollar strengthened 0.4% versus the Turkish lira but dipped 0.2% relative to the Swiss franc and o.1% versus the euro and peso. Rate Hike at National Bank of Ukraine
December 10, 2021
officials at the National Bank of Ukraine chimed in with their fifth rate hike of 2021, a 50-basis point increase to 9.0% that follows 250 basis points of tightening from the four earlier moves.
